A further six COVID-19 deaths have sadly been recorded, the Scottish Government has confirmed.
In the latest daily figures, announced this afternoon, a further 563 positive coronavirus cases have been reported across the country, representing 2.4% of all tests undertaken. 543 cases were recorded on Friday.
157 of the new cases were reported in the NHS Greater Glasgow and Clyde region, with 100 in Lanarkshire.
283 people are in hospital with recently confirmed COVID-19, while 26 are in intensive care.
Meanwhile, the government advised 2,358,807 people have received their first dose of the covid-19 vaccine.
